Over the past three years, AHM academic staff member Prof. Rob van der Laarse has led the HERA research project 'Accessing Campscapes. Inclusive strategies for European conflicted heritage' about the current role of former war and work camps in the national and European commemorative cultures.

Now the project is in its final stage, publications about results and public meetings in iC-ACCESS are available to get informed about its findings, such as an interview with historian Stephanie Billib, head of the education department at Bergen-Belsen, and an interview with archaeologist Pavel Vareka about the Czech Romani camp Lety.
